Rigetti Establishes Dedicated Systems Delivery Organization to Scale On-Premises Deployments

Superconducting quantum hardware developer Rigetti Computing, Inc. (Nasdaq: RGTI) has reorganized its operating structure to separate commercial system deployments from core quantum processor R&D. The company has established a dedicated Systems Delivery organization to manage manufacturing operations, commercial sales, and customer-facing engineering, while consolidating all hardware engineering and chiplet development into a streamlined Technology organization.

Scaling On-Premises Deployments and Isolating R&D
Historically, customer installation and field support activities were handled directly within Rigetti's core engineering group. The structural shift isolates commercial delivery logistics from core hardware research, allowing the R&D team to focus exclusively on processor fidelity and roadmap execution:
Commercial System Demand: The dedicated delivery unit will manage scaling and deployment for on-premises hardware, ranging from the 9-qubit Novera QPU to 36-qubit systems and large-scale 108-qubit Cepheus-class systems deployed at national laboratories and quantum computing centers.
Cepheus-1-108Q Performance Targets: The technology organization remains focused on achieving its benchmark target of 99.5% median two-qubit gate (CZ) fidelity on the Cepheus-1-108Q platform—a 108-qubit QPU constructed by tiling twelve 9-qubit chiplets together using inter-module couplers.
Fab-1 Integration: Manufacturing operations at Fab-1—the company's integrated quantum device manufacturing facility in Berkeley, California—will align directly with the Systems Delivery arm to streamline assembly, testing, and delivery schedules.
